If Beaver Dam was feeling good fresh off their 9-1 takedown of Appleton East on Friday, their most recent game may have dampened their spirits a bit. The Golden Beavers fell just short of the Elkhorn Elks by a score of 4-3 on Tuesday. The Golden Beavers were given a dose of their own medicine in this game as the Elks apparently hadn't forgotten their defeat the last time these teams played back in May of 2025.
Beaver Dam's loss dropped their record down to 12-11. As for Elkhorn, their win bumped their record up to 14-8.
Both teams will have to hit the road in their upcoming contests. Beaver Dam will venture away from home to take on Jefferson at 4:30 p.m. on Wednesday. The Eagles will roll in looking for their ninth straight victory, something the Golden Beavers surely won't give up without a fight. As for Elkhorn, they will take on Milton at 4:30 p.m. on Thursday. The Red Hawks' pitching crew has only allowed 3.2 runs per game this season, so the Elks' hitters will have their work cut out for them.
